Understanding Designated Agents

A designated agent is an entity or business designated to accept legal documents on behalf of a company or LLC. This comprises important paperwork such as tax-related documents, legal summons, and compliance communications. Having a registered agent is a legal requirement in most states, guaranteeing that there is a reliable point of contact for official correspondence.

Lawful Duties of Registered Agents

Official representatives have crucial lawful duties that make sure companies stay compliant with state regulations. One main responsibility is to receive and manage all legal papers on behalf of the company, including process serving, legal alerts, and state communications. This function is critical for maintaining positive standing with the state and making sure that the business is promptly notified of any lawful actions or changes in laws that may affect its activities.

In addition obtaining legal papers, registered representatives are accountable for maintaining accurate records of these notices. They must make sure that all documents are processed and delivered to the correct people in a timely manner. Neglect to do so can result in overlooked deadlines or problems for the company, highlighting the significance of choosing a trustworthy and diligent registered agent provider. This service typically manages important regulatory deadlines and makes sure that the company adheres to necessary lawful requirements.

Additionally, registered agents must offer a physical address for process serving that is available during standard operating hours. This obligation ensures that legal notifications can be delivered without delay. Companies that do not keep a registered agent in positive condition face penalties and could encounter challenges in defending themselves in lawful matters. Thus, selecting a reliable official representative is essential for companies to uphold their lawful obligations effectively.
